What do the key Fortnite value terms mean?

New to Fortnite value? These are the terms that matter most:

Crew Pack
A monthly subscription that grants a recurring V-Bucks allotment, the current Battle Pass, and an exclusive Crew-only cosmetic bundle.
Account level
A cumulative measure of a player's total experience earned across seasons, reflecting long-term playtime and engagement.
Item Shop
Fortnite's rotating storefront where cosmetics are offered for V-Bucks, with selections that change daily and cycle unpredictably.
Back Bling
A cosmetic accessory worn on a character's back, such as a backpack, cape, or shield, purely for visual customization.
Locker
The in-game menu where a player's owned cosmetics are stored and equipped, effectively a showcase of everything they have collected.
Save the World
Fortnite's cooperative player-versus-environment campaign mode, separate from Battle Royale, with its own progression and rewards.

Why did my Fortnite account value change over time?

Estimates shift because a cosmetic's perceived rarity can change. When an item returns to the shop it becomes easier to obtain and may weigh less, while items that stay absent for longer can grow more coveted. Community interest also evolves. Since the figure tracks these public trends, it naturally moves up or down over time.

What are the rarest skins in Fortnite?

Some of the most sought-after cosmetics include early Battle Pass and event exclusives like Renegade Raider, Aerial Assault Trooper, Black Knight, and rare promotional items such as Galaxy or Ikonik. Rarity depends on limited availability and how long ago an item last appeared, which is why these older exclusives tend to stand out most in a collection.

Why do rare Fortnite skins cost more in the estimate?

Rarity drives the figure because items that appear infrequently or were tied to limited events are harder to obtain and more coveted by the community. The fewer players who can readily get an item, the more it tends to weigh in the calculation. Common, always-available cosmetics carry comparatively little in the informational estimate.
